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
What is a reciprocating cycle linear actuator?
A reciprocating cycle linear actuator is a device that converts rotary motion into linear motion, enabling it to push or pull loads in a straight line. These actuators are commonly used in various applications, such as robotics, manufacturing, and automation, where precise movement is essential.
How does a reciprocating cycle linear actuator generate force?
These actuators generate force by using a motor to rotate a screw or a crank mechanism. As the motor turns, it moves a connected rod or piston back and forth, creating linear motion. The amount of force produced depends on the actuator’s design and the input power.
What factors should I consider when choosing a linear actuator?
When selecting a linear actuator, consider the required load capacity, speed, stroke length, and duty cycle. Additionally, think about the environment where it will operate, such as temperature and humidity, as well as the power source, whether electric, pneumatic, or hydraulic.
Can reciprocating cycle linear actuators be used in outdoor applications?
Yes, many reciprocating cycle linear actuators are designed for outdoor use. However, it’s important to choose models with appropriate weatherproofing and materials that can withstand environmental conditions, such as moisture, dust, and temperature fluctuations, to ensure longevity and performance.
How do I maintain a reciprocating cycle linear actuator?
To maintain your linear actuator, regularly check for wear and tear, clean any debris, and lubricate moving parts as needed. It’s also wise to inspect electrical connections and ensure the actuator is operating within its specified limits to prevent overheating or damage.
